SOFTBALL Springfield 4, Hartford 1
May 21,2016
SPRINGFIELD — Hartford’s Gary Gervais deployed a gimmick defense and it worked well for five innings as the Hurricanes, who were beaten by Springfield 16-0 the first time around, found themselves in a 1-1 tie after five innings.
But the Cosmos beat the reconfigured outfield defense with three triples in the bottom of the sixth. Lena Guyer had the first triple and scored on Cassidy Otis’ sacrifice fly. Winning pitcher Jade Twombly and Hannah Crosby then had back-to-back RBI triples.
Twombly rang up 11 strikeouts in winning her three-hitter.
Brooke Hurd went the distance for Hartford.
“She pitched well,” Bladyka said.
The win lifts the Cosmos to 11-2 and they head to Mount Anthony on Monday.
Hartford is 7-7.
Bladyka must have been having flashbacks as Gervais’ Hurricanes upset the Cosmos in the playoffs a few years ago with a similar defense.
